The Historical Context of the Chinese Communist Party
Founded in 1921, the Chinese Communist Party (CCP) has played a pivotal role in shaping modern China. Its journey from a small revolutionary movement to becoming the ruling party of the world's most populous nation is a testament to its adaptability and resilience. Understanding the historical context of the CCP is crucial to comprehending its current position.
The CCP emerged during a tumultuous period in Chinese history, marked by political instability and foreign intervention. Under the leadership of Mao Zedong, the party led a successful revolution, establishing the People's Republic of China in 1949. Since then, the CCP has undergone significant transformations, adapting to changing domestic and international circumstances.
Key Events in CCP History
- 1949: Establishment of the People's Republic of China
- 1978: Economic Reforms under Deng Xiaoping
- 2012: Xi Jinping's rise to power
Each of these events has contributed to the CCP's evolution, reinforcing its position as a dominant political force in China.

Factors Contributing to Political Stability
One of the primary reasons the "中共 滭亡" narrative is flawed is the CCP's ability to maintain political stability. Several factors contribute to this stability, including a strong centralized government, effective governance mechanisms, and a well-organized bureaucracy.
The CCP's emphasis on maintaining social harmony and addressing public grievances has helped prevent widespread unrest. Additionally, the party's ability to co-opt potential opposition by offering positions of power has further strengthened its grip on power.
Institutional Strengths
- Centralized decision-making processes
- Effective propaganda and media control
- Strong enforcement of laws and regulations
These institutional strengths have enabled the CCP to navigate various challenges, ensuring its continued dominance in Chinese politics.
The Role of Economic Growth in CCP Resilience
Economic growth has been a cornerstone of the CCP's resilience. Since the economic reforms of the late 1970s, China has experienced rapid economic development, lifting millions out of poverty and transforming the country into a global economic powerhouse.
The CCP's ability to deliver economic prosperity has bolstered its legitimacy in the eyes of the Chinese people. By prioritizing economic development, the party has managed to maintain public support, even in the face of political dissent.
Key Economic Achievements
- China's GDP surpassing $15 trillion in 2022
- Significant investments in infrastructure and technology
- Expansion of the middle class
These achievements highlight the CCP's success in leveraging economic growth to reinforce its political position.

Key Challenges Facing the CCP
Despite its successes, the CCP faces several challenges that could impact its long-term stability. Issues such as economic inequality, environmental degradation, and demographic shifts pose significant threats to the party's ability to maintain public support.
Additionally, international pressures, including trade tensions and human rights concerns, have added complexity to China's geopolitical landscape. Addressing these challenges will require the CCP to adopt innovative solutions and adapt to changing global dynamics.
Major Challenges
- Addressing economic inequality
- Tackling environmental issues
- Managing demographic changes
By proactively addressing these challenges, the CCP can ensure its continued relevance and resilience in the years to come.
China's Role in Global Politics
China's rise as a global superpower has reshaped international relations, challenging the dominance of Western nations. The CCP's foreign policy initiatives, such as the Belt and Road Initiative (BRI), have expanded China's influence across continents, fostering economic partnerships and strengthening diplomatic ties.
However, China's growing global presence has also sparked concerns among some nations, leading to increased scrutiny of its trade practices and human rights record. Navigating these complexities will require the CCP to balance its domestic priorities with its international ambitions.
Global Initiatives
- Belt and Road Initiative (BRI)
- Participation in international organizations
- Expansion of military capabilities
These initiatives underscore China's commitment to playing a leading role in shaping the global order.
